This is a list of decisions of the United States Supreme Court that have been abrogated (superseded), in whole or in part, by a subsequent constitutional amendment or Congressional statute. This list does not included decisions overruled by the subsequent Supreme Court decisions.

By Constitutional amendment[edit]

Abrogated decision Abrogating amendment Summary (topic) of amendment
Chisholm v. Georgia, 2 U.S. 419 (1793) Eleventh Amendment (1795) Civil jurisdiction (state sovereign immunity) of the States
Dred Scott v. Sandford, 60 U.S. 393 (1857) Thirteenth Amendment (1865) Slavery and involuntary servitude
Fourteenth Amendment (1868) Citizenship rights and equal protection of the laws
Pollock v. Farmers' Loan & Trust Co., 157 U.S. 429 (1895),
affirmed on rehearing, 158 U.S. 601 (1895)
Sixteenth Amendment (1913) Ability to impose federal income tax on all forms of income without state apportionment
Minor v. Happersett, 88 U.S. 162 (1875) Nineteenth Amendment (1920) Right to vote of men and women
Oregon v. Mitchell, 400 U.S. 112 (1970) Twenty-sixth Amendment (1971) Right to vote of adults (highest threshold age: 18)
